Discovering the Sights Along Avenida do Mar

Avenida do Mar offers many captivating sights. Start your journey at the Funchal Marina. Here, luxury yachts bob gently on the water. You can watch boats come and go. Consider a boat trip from this lively spot.

Nearby, visit the famous CR7 Museum. It celebrates Cristiano Ronaldo's career. Football fans will find his trophies and memorabilia here. The museum is a major draw for visitors. It honors Madeira's most famous son.

Walk a bit further to Santa Catarina Park. This beautiful green space provides stunning ocean views. It is perfect for a relaxing afternoon. You will find exotic plants and peaceful pathways. It is an ideal spot for Funchal street photography.

The Funchal Cable Car station is also close by. It offers a scenic ride up to Monte. From there, enjoy panoramic views of the city. This attraction provides an excellent perspective. It highlights Funchal's natural beauty. Explore more historic landmarks in Funchal.

Enjoying Culinary Delights and Cafes

Avenida do Mar is a haven for food lovers. You will find numerous restaurants and cafes here. They offer a taste of local and international cuisine. Enjoy fresh seafood caught daily.

Many establishments boast outdoor seating. This allows you to dine with ocean views. Try traditional Madeiran dishes, like Espetada. It is grilled beef on a skewer. Fresh local produce enhances every meal.

Coffee shops line the avenue. They are perfect for a morning pastry and espresso. Enjoy a bica (espresso) like a true local. Some cafes transform into lively bars at night. Explore the Funchal restaurant streets for more options. These spots are great for people-watching.

Don't miss trying Bolo do Caco, a traditional bread. It often comes with garlic butter. This delightful snack is widely available. Many consider these among the best cafes in Funchal. Look for small kiosks offering local treats too. You might find delicious Funchal street food.

Shopping for Souvenirs and Local Crafts

Avenida do Mar and its surroundings offer great shopping. You can find unique souvenirs to take home. Browse through various small shops. They feature local crafts and products.

Look for traditional Madeiran embroidery. It is famous worldwide for its quality. You can also find intricate wicker items. These reflect the island's artisanal heritage. They make perfect gifts for loved ones.

Many shops sell local wines and spirits. Madeira wine is especially renowned. Sample some before making a purchase. You can also buy local honey cake. It is a dense, delicious treat. Visit the Funchal souvenir shops for unique finds. Some shops also offer duty-free items.

For more extensive shopping, venture into nearby streets. They connect directly to Funchal's main avenue. These areas provide a wider selection of goods. Explore these shopping streets in Funchal. You might find unexpected treasures during your visit.

As evening falls, Avenida do Mar transforms. The lights twinkle along the promenade. It becomes a perfect place for a leisurely walk. The cooler air is refreshing after a warm day.

Enjoy the vibrant atmosphere after dark. Many restaurants and bars stay open late. Listen to live music emanating from various venues. Locals and tourists alike enjoy the evening buzz. These Funchal evening strolls are truly magical. They offer a different perspective of the city.

Seasonal events often take place here. Check local listings for concerts or festivals. During Christmas, Avenida do Mar shines brightly. Festive lights adorn the entire area. It creates a truly magical experience. Don't miss the beautiful Funchal streets at night.

For a lively night out, visit bars near the Old Town. Many are just a short walk away. Enjoy a poncha, Madeira's traditional drink. It is a strong, local concoction. Some of the bars in Funchal Old Town offer fantastic ambiance. You can dance or simply relax with a drink.
